Police reports from local municipalities

• FLAGAMI AREA

A thief stole a computer bag, an overnight bag and clothes after breaking a door lock on a 2003 Cadillac Escalade at the corner of 79th Avenue and West Flagler Street between 2:15 and 2:45 p.m. May 1. The stolen items were valued at $400. Damage was estimated at $150.

• WEST MIAMI

A thief drove away with a 2004 Mercedes-Benz valued at $48,000 from a house in the 1800 block of Southwest 63rd Avenue between 11:45 p.m. May 2 and 7:30 a.m. May 3.

• CORAL GABLES

A man with a knife robbed a man taking out the trash in the alley behind his home in the 200 block of Cadima Avenue at 1:45 p.m. April 30. The robber approached the man from behind and demanded his wallet. When the man turned around, the robber pulled out a kitchen knife and pressed it close to the victim's body. The robber got away.

Burglars kicked in the front door of a house in the 1400 block of Obispo Avenue, making off with antique jewelry including a Rolex watch between 2 and 2:15 p.m. May 1. The burglars also made off with clothes, money and a plasma television. A neighbor called police after spotting a white BMW SUV parked outside of the house, the front door wide open, and an unknown man and woman walking in and out of the house. When police arrived, the burglars were gone.

• CORAL GABLES AREA

A thief stole two bags, a book, a camera, clothes and makeup from a 2006 Lincoln in the 2400 block of Southwest 58th Avenue between 10 a.m. and noon April 30. The stolen items were valued at $1,320.

• LITTLE GABLES

A thief stole a purse, credit cards and $60 from a 2003 Honda LX at the corner of 42nd Avenue and Southwest Eighth Street at 11 p.m. May 5. The stolen items were valued at $338.

• SOUTH MIAMI

A man snatched a purse containing a cellphone, a passport, debit cards and $100 cash from a woman walking in the 7000 block of Southwest 59th Place at 11:45 p.m. May 1.

• BLUE LAGOON AREA

A thief made off with a GPS and DVD player after breaking a window on a 2006 Chrysler in the 5800 block of Blue Lagoon Drive between 8 p.m. April 30 and 6:30 a.m. May 1. The stolen items were valued at $500. Damage was estimated at $300.

A thief stole a GPS after breaking a window on a 2008 Hyundai in the 5500 block of Blue Lagoon Drive between 6 p.m. April 30 and 8:30 a.m. May 1. The GPS was valued at $250. Damage was estimated at $125.

A thief broke a window on a 2002 Chevrolet Malibu in the 5800 block of Blue Lagoon Drive between 7 a.m. and 3 p.m. May 1 Damage was estimated at $100.

• KINLOCH PARK AREA

A thief tried to steal five packs of gum from a store at 222 NW 37th Ave. at 6:15 p.m. March 27.

• LITTLE HAVANA

A thief stole a garbage can outside the front of a house in the 2200 block of West Flagler Street at 8 p.m. March 28. The victim told police he heard a loud noise, went outside and found the garbage can missing.

A man riding a bicycle snatched a woman's purse off a passenger seat after reaching into her car window while she was waiting at the intersection of Southwest 37th Avenue and West Flagler Street March 31.

A thief stole property from outside a house in the 2000 block of West Flagler Street between 7 p.m. April 4 and 9:30 a.m. April 5.

• EAST LITTLE HAVANA

Someone broke into a trailer at a construction site at 90 SW Third St. between 5 p.m. April 2 and 6 a.m. April 3. Damage was estimated at $ 21,150.

This list is a sampling of crime in unincorporated Miami-Dade County and various cities. The information is taken from official police reports, which do not necessarily contain statements from all parties involved in each case.
